We have some troubles with DRV8323 analog path. There is BLDC controller board with DRV in each of two channels. We have tested one channel driving power stage to a constant duty cycle that lead to ~40A current trough the load. Voltage drop across the low side current shunt meets expectation (square waveform), ut output. But output signal from DRVs current sense amplifier was dirty and useless.
What we did:
1) Cut SNx pins from common ground plane and connect them to current shunts directly (by wires);
2) Removed output filters on SOx pins;
3) Removed decoupling capacitors on FETs (C56, C57, C58 on schematic);
4) Shorted ferrite bead (FB5, FB6) between signal and power ground planes.
But output signal still contains strange long transient. This makes measurements unusable. What could be the reason?
